Understanding the Visual Power of Ring Width
Wedding ring width is generally measured across the band from one edge to the other.
A narrow band leaves more visible finger around it, while a wide band occupies more visual space.
Rather than searching for a universally correct measurement, it is more useful to understand what different widths tend to communicate visually.

What a 6mm Wedding Band Says
A 6mm wedding band creates a noticeably substantial appearance on many hands.
For someone who rarely wears jewelry, a 6mm band can initially feel more noticeable than a narrow ring.
A plain polished 6mm band can look traditional, a brushed version can feel understated and contemporary, while beveled edges, textures or mixed materials can produce a more distinctive appearance.

Understanding Wedding Ring Dimensions
Width describes how much finger length the band covers, while thickness relates to how far the ring's material extends outward and through its profile.
Edge design and interior profile add further differences.
Always consider the complete proportions.

The Same Width Can Have Different Visual Weight
On a narrow band, polish can help a subtle proportion remain visually crisp.
A 6mm brushed band can therefore feel visually different from a polished 6mm ring despite having identical measurements.
